2. Horizon Fitness T101 Treadmill

The T101 treadmill from Horizon Fitness is one of the most budget-friendly models available on the market. It comes with an 2.5 CHP motor that can reach speeds up to 10 mph and an adjustable incline feature that can be set up to 10 percent. It's a great option for runners who want to improve their fitness by adding some variety to their routines. The running surface measures 20 inches wide and 55 inches long which allows the majority of people to walk and what do treadmill incline numbers mean other exercises such as side shuffles.

In contrast to other treadmills, the T101 features QuickDial controls at the edges of each handrail. These controls allow you to adjust the speed and the incline. You can increase your speed by rolling the dials forward or decrease it by turning them backwards. This system makes it easier to regulate your pace and make bigger shifts in direction rather than having to use buttons on a console. This treadmill is also equipped with sensors for pulses in the handrails to track your heart rate. We recommend using a chest strap for the most precise results.

The treadmill comes with an easy-to-use interface that includes nine pre-programmed workouts that will aid you in achieving your fitness goals. You can also listen to your favorite music with the built-in speakers or view a movie on the screen while exercising. You can connect your tablet or smartphone to the treadmill to stream fitness classes and apps like Peloton.

3. Sole F80 Treadmill

The F80 is an excellent treadmill for those who wish to add modern features to their fitness center without breaking the bank. With a 3.5 HP motor and a folding design, the F80 is a reliable mid-range treadmill that can give you everything you need for your workouts. The 10.1-inch touchscreen display comes preloaded with seven apps which include YouTube, Netflix, ESPN and other news apps. It also lets you screen mirror your phone or tablet onto the console so you can watch a film or TV show while working out. There are also Bluetooth speakers, so you can skip the earbuds and enjoy your workout with music.

The Sole F80 has built-in fans that are located above the console. This will provide an enjoyable breeze while you work out. This is particularly useful when you're a runner or someone who gets sweaty when working out. Sole Fitness offers a smartphone application that allows you to monitor your progress. The app also offers thousands of workouts and professional advice from top trainers. There's a device holder that can be used with most electronic devices above the console if you want to connect a smartphone or tablet.

Cushioning is another feature of the Sole F80. It helps reduce the impact to your joints when you exercise. The Sole F80 uses a Cushion Flex Whisper Deck that is 40 percent more shock-absorbing than running on pavement. This can help prevent joint pain and injury and make your exercise more comfortable.

One of the greatest features of this treadmill is its warranty, which is a lot superior to other brands. Sole Fitness offers a life-time warranty on this treadmill's motor and frame, and a 5-year warranty on its electronic components and parts. Sole Fitness also offers two-year labor warranty that is more than the average for this price.

The Sole F80 weighs 278 pounds. It might not be the best choice for those who have a limited space. It does have four wheels, which make it easier to move.
